Output 8601c6c61605b4c34d591766c3a6ae6aa09a47ce5271b86c3bc4e1774e19a604:1

value
130015919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84648883ac8e1c0290e93b88b110770c0e82bd3a OP_EQUAL
address
3Dm3Z3CMmX2RDzTeUuMVWTveKbGEAvsX7t
transaction
8601c6c61605b4c34d591766c3a6ae6aa09a47ce5271b86c3bc4e1774e19a604
spent
true